When the watch is switched from the chro-
nograph mode to log modepressing button
(M)
log I is displayed.
Every dive makes the watch memorize the following 8 types of log data automatically,
which can be recalled in the order of I, II, III and IV as shown on the right side.
Each time button
(A)
is pressed, the log
display is changed to the next in the order
of I, II, II and IV.
Only when log I is displayed, the display is
automatically changed to log II after 2 second
without pressing button
(A)
.
ATTENTION: On rare occassions, even if the water sensor senses traces of water and the watch
is switched to the dive mode (Ready state) however, log I display may fail to change to log II
display automatically. In case this happens, press button
(A)
to change the display.
